New African American Literature and History Collection

Created By: Seyvion Scott, M.S.I.S., First Year Experience Librarian, at MCC Libraries

The African American Literature and History library guide is designed to educate college students, faculty and staff, and the broader Rochester community on the unique and powerful legacies of local African American leaders from Rochester, NY. Created by Seyvion Scott, the First-Year Experience Librarian, in honor of the Black History Month Celebration at Monroe Community College (MCC), this is the first subject guide to bring awareness to a unique cohort of African American historical figures. In honoring and remembering the rich cultural histories, accomplishments, and monumental endeavors of outstanding African Americans from yesteryear, we bring awareness to their legacies and recognize the positive social change each individual had on the City of Rochester and the United States at large. Inside this guide you will discover new books added to our library's print and digital collections, a description of each item, and a brief excerpt about each African American historical figure who created lasting social change in their lifetimes.
